Yet another UN idiot/fraudster suggests that CO2 has increased flooding 4X in 20 years
"The problem we are facing today is that the capacity [of relief agencies] has been overwhelmed," Kasidis Rochanakorn, head of the UN Office for Coordination of Humanitarian Affairs (OCHA), told a press conference.

"Climate change is here and it's here now... the impact is clear to us, the burden is getting heavier," he said.

"Over the past 20 years, the number of reported disasters has doubled from roughly 200 [per year] to 400. Today, floods are happening more frequently. In 1985, we used to have 50 floods per year. In 2005, the number jumped to 200."
Arctic Sea Ice News & Analysis
Ice extent for the month of November was 580,000 square kilometers (220,000 square miles) greater than November 2007...The daily rate of ice growth has slowed simply because there is less physical room for ice to grow: the area of open water shrinks as ice fills it.
